Songs of the Soul NY
Recently, members of the Sri Chinmoy Centre offered a concert of Sri Chinmoy's music at the New York Society for Ethical Culture in Manhattan.

The concert featured music from Ghandarva Loka and also contributions from the Russian music legend, Boris Purushottama Grebenshikov. The music was composed by Sri Chinmoy in English or his native Bengali.

The concert, which was free for members of the public, was part of the 81st birthday celebrations for Sri Chinmoy. Over 1,000 people visited New York from all other the world to take part in events of meditation, music and sport.
